Both are learning management systems, but they do not do the same job. Moodle is open-source infrastructure — installing and running it is on you. Vedubox is a service that already works — setup and maintenance are on us.
| Criterion | Vedubox | Moodle |
|---|---|---|
| Setup | Same dayOpen an account and start using it straight away. | Technical resourceA server, a database and configuration are required. |
| Maintenance and updates | On usNew versions arrive automatically. | On youSecurity patches and version upgrades are your organisation's responsibility. |
| Live training | Built inInside the platform; Zoom, Teams and Webex can also be connected. | Via a pluginAn external tool integration is needed. |
| Exams and certification | Built inQuestion banks, proctored exams and certificate management. | PartlyBasic exams exist; proctoring and advanced certification need plugins. |
| Who runs it | HR / L&D teamA dashboard you can run without technical help. | Usually ITFlexible, but a steep learning curve. |
| Customisation | White-labelBranding, domain and portal design can all be changed. | UnlimitedRight down to the source code — Moodle is freer on this one. |
| Support | From the vendorSupport in English; phone and video calls included depending on your plan. | Community / partnerForums, or paid partner firms. |
| Data and UK GDPR | Certified cloudInfrastructure certified to ISO 27001, 27701 and 9001. | Down to youCompliance rests entirely with your organisation. |
| Cost structure | All inclusiveA single subscription line based on user capacity. | Licence is freeThe cost shows up in servers, installation, maintenance and staff time. |
| SCORM and content | Built inSCORM, video, PDF, presentations and interactive video. | SCORM onlyInteractive content needs a separate tool. |
Vedubox comes out ahead on nine of the ten criteria. Moodle wins on customisation — if you need to change things at source-code level, that is the right place to go.
Moodle's software licence really is free. But the cost of a system is not only its licence. The items below stay with your organisation on Moodle; with Vedubox they are part of the subscription.
A monthly cost that grows with your user numbers. Add live training and bandwidth joins the bill too.
It looks like a one-off, but in practice theme, plugin and integration settings stretch it across weeks.
A system you forget to patch is a serious risk, because it holds your employees' personal data.
If one of your plugins breaks during a version upgrade, finding the fix is your job.
The least visible item of all. The time of whoever keeps the system running never appears in the budget, but it is still spent.
We are not trying to make Moodle look expensive. In organisations that already have a technical team, these costs may well be covered. Where they are not, the word “free” becomes misleading.
